Mesothelioma Claims

Compensation claims are usually made by patients with mesothelioma and their families. This compensation could come from trust funds, lawsuit payouts, or Department of Veterans Affairs (VA) benefits.

A law firm that is experienced in filing mesothelioma claims can help victims and loved ones seek justice they deserve. A mesothelioma lawyer can help make the process less stressful.

Work History

Mesothelioma patients are eligible for compensation from a variety of insurance. People diagnosed with Mesothelioma are able to make a personal injury claim against asbestos companies who exposed them. Compensation may cover medical expenses, lost wages, and funeral expenses.

Mesothelioma lawsuits can result in significant awards that can help patients and their families recover from the terrible effects of this disease. These lawsuits also hold accountable the companies accountable for asbestos, and urge them to prevent the risk of exposure to asbestos in the future.

Veterans who were exposed to asbestos while in the armed forces could also be eligible for benefits of the veteran like disability benefits. VA benefits can be used to help families to pay for the treatment of mesothelioma, as well as other expenses related to this disease.

A person with mesothelioma should work with a mesothelioma attorney to determine their eligibility for a lawsuit, trust fund or other kind of compensation. Based on the type of claim filed, it may be necessary to collect medical records, a job history and other proof to prove the claim.

Experienced mesothelioma attorneys will know the best way for gathering and analyzing this evidence to ensure all legal rights are secured. In addition, they are able to work with health insurers and the VA to access all eligible compensation options.

People diagnosed with mesothelioma may also be able to get the compensation offered by asbestos trusts. Many asbestos companies have established trusts to compensate injured people without having to resort to litigation. An experienced mesothelioma law firm can assist people in determining whether the company responsible for their exposure is a member of an trust and guide through the steps of filing an insurance claim.

Mesothelioma trust funds provide compensatory awards based on a person's asbestos exposure as well as their diagnosis. However the funds are not unlimited and some have reached their limit. As a result, eligible victims must consider filing multiple trusts.

Mesothelioma attorneys with national connections can assist those making this decision. They can also assist in coordinating mesothelioma lawsuits and trust fund claims to ensure that the client receives the maximum compensation.

Asbestos Exposure

If an asbestos-related victim suffers from mesothelioma, or another asbestos-related illness, he or she can file for compensation. This can be used to pay for medical expenses and other costs related to treatment. Compensation also gives victims peace of mind and provide support for their families. A mesothelioma attorney can guide victims through the claim process and protect their legal rights.

Mesothelioma affects the thin membranes that surround the organs and joints of the body. It is almost always caused by exposure to asbestos, which is a class of minerals with tiny fibres. These fibres are easily breathed in or eaten and cause lung damage. Many workers were exposed to asbestos during the 20th century, when it was employed for a variety purposes.

Asbestos victims can make a claim against the manufacturers who exposed them to the dangerous material. These lawsuits could result in an out-of-court settlement or a court verdict. Many mesothelioma cases are settled before reaching trial.

A qualified asbestos lawyer can look over the work history of patients to determine the time and the location they were exposed. The lawyers can identify the responsible parties. The list could include asbestos-related companies, as well as producers of asbestos-containing construction materials or products and shipyards.

The strength of a mesothelioma case can be significantly improved by determining the extent of an individual's exposure to asbestos. Asbestos lawyers can examine medical documents, laboratory tests, and other evidence to calculate the amount of asbestos exposure a patient has and the extent of their mesothelioma.

In some cases, a mesothelioma victim's family can file a wrongful-death claim to obtain compensation on his or her behalf. A lawyer can assist families learn about the statute of limitations for mesothelioma as well as any other regulations or rules that might apply.

In addition, mesothelioma patients and their families can apply for workers' compensation or disability benefits. These can help cover lost income and help pay for living expenses. Additionally, mesothelioma law firms patients could be eligible for special monthly payments from the Department of Veterans Affairs.

Statute of limitations

A statute of limitations is a law that defines the time limit for when victims have to make a claim. The length of the statute of limitations differs by state, and it is also dependent on the type of claim that is filed. Mesothelioma lawsuits typically have different limitations periods than other personal injury lawsuits. This is because mesothelioma can take decades to manifest, and many victims will not be aware of the illness until they're diagnosed with it.

For this reason, it is crucial that mesothelioma sufferers seek out a lawyer as quickly as possible. A specialist can assist patients file their claim promptly and collect all the necessary documentation for the case.

A mesothelioma lawsuit can be filed against any company that exposed the victim to asbestos, which includes the responsible party's insurance firms. Victims can seek compensation for medical expenses, pain and discomfort, and other damages. They can also receive a settlement to cover lost income due to being unable work due to illness.

Additionally, family members of mesothelioma patients may make wrongful death claims against the responsible parties. In general, the statute of limitations begins to run when the patient dies. However, certain states have rules that allow the statute of limitations clock to start when the victim was diagnosed with mesothelioma.

It is essential to make a claim for mesothelioma on time since evidence diminishes over time. Some states have shorter statutes for asbestos cases than others.

The time limit for filing a mesothelioma case will depend on where the defendants reside and where the victim resides or worked. In general, a mesothelioma suit must be filed in the state where the exposure occurred.

A mesothelioma attorney must also be aware of the specific statutes of limitation in every state. This will ensure that claims are timely filed and the victim is not denied their right to compensation.
